Hungary Sells More Treasury Bills Than Planned At Auction of 3-Month Debt
Hungary today sold 50 billion forint ($228 million) of three-month Treasury bills, 5 billion forint more than planned, at an average yield of 5.46 percent compared with 5.47 percent at the previous auction of the similar maturity on July 20, according to auction results on the debt management agency’s Bloomberg page.
Investors submitted bids worth 133.3 billion forint versus 52.5 billion forint a week ago, according to the results.
